The Banyan Estate is the premier, historic event venue in Brevard County, Florida. Today, you can still see the beauty and grace of the property starting with the classical architecture and continuing with the spacious grounds. Not the least of which is the magnificent Banyan Tree that has flourished on the back lawn and inspired the naming of The Banyan Estate. Built as the area’s first county school in 1927, the Historic Malabar Schoolhouse has been used for many purposes over the years and the owners continue to meet local residents who know and love the property and add to its unique vintage character. The owners of The Banyan Estate have always had a love for historic architecture and vintage elements. As you step onto the Banyan Estate, each room and outdoor space shows you its own personality and elegance providing a perfect backdrop to add your style and creativity to your special event. The A&H’s Maitland Art Center, originally known as the Research Studio, was founded in 1937 by visionary artist and architect J. André Smith. The center was originally a winter artist’s colony, dedicated to fostering an exploratory approach to modern art. The hundreds of original sculptural elements that adorn the structures were hand-carved by André Smith and his associates, and the center remains one of the few surviving examples of Mayan Revival architecture in the southeastern United States.

How much do wedding venues typically cost in Cocoa, FL?

The cost of a wedding venue varies widely by location, number of guests, and many other details of the wedding package. Cocoa, FL offers a range of options that can fit most budgets. Raw venue space rentals (which only include the space itself) start at $800 and average $5,000. All-inclusive packages start at $1,000 and average $3,700.

What questions should I ask when booking a venue in Cocoa, FL?

It all depends on what you're looking for, but you may want to consider things like whether the venue has an on-site bridal suite (52% in Cocoa do) or whether the venue provides an event coordinator (33% in Cocoa do!).

Additionally, some venues work with certain caterers and require a minimum food and beverage spend in addition to the space rentals. Others might have a recommended list of preferred caterers that they'd like you to work with.

Can the venues in Cocoa, FL accommodate both small and large weddings?

Of course! Small wedding venues in Cocoa, FL can host intimate parties while large venues can accommodate up to 500. The average venue in Cocoa can seat 130 guests.
